New day, new Samsung updates – today the Android 13 firmware with One UI 5 arrived for the Galaxy A71 5G, among others. The phone came out with Android 10 in early 2020, got Android 11 with One UI 3 in early 2021, and Android 12 with One UI 4.1 in March. Now there is the next major release of Samsungs software with the latest Android features.

The Galaxy A71 5G will receive firmware version A716BXXU6EVL2 and it seems that the United Arab Emirates will be the first to go. However, this is only the preliminary rollout and the update should be extended to Europe and Asia in the coming days.
The new firmware also includes new versions of Samsung’s core apps, including the camera app, gallery and keyboard. The latter can now extract text from images. There are also new AR emojis, emoji pairs and kaomojis. Samsung has merged the security and data protection pages and is including the current security patch from December 2022. By the way, Samsung updated the 4G version of the Galaxy A71 to Android 13 in November. The Galaxy A51 5G jumped on the Android 13 bandwagon yesterday.
Samsung Galaxy S10 Lite and Galaxy Tab S7 FE
Similar to the A71, the Samsung Galaxy S10 Lite launched in early 2020 with Android 10 and One UI 2. It is also updated to One UI 5 / Android 13 and gets firmware version G770FXXU6HVK5. The update still includes the older security patch from November 2022. The rollout has started with unlocked and Vodafone devices in the Netherlands.

Owners of the Samsung Galaxy Tab S7 FE can also look forward to the new operating system. Samsung is currently updating devices in the UK with firmware T736BXXU1CVL1, which also includes the older November 2022 security patch.
